GREENVILLE, S.C. (FOX Carolina) – Humidity builds Friday ahead of two First Alert Weather Days Saturday and Sunday. Scattered showers and storms increase through the weekend. Friday brings a typical late June day with highs in the mid 80s to right around 90. But the humidity starts to build back in which makes it feel more uncomfortable than previous days. We do have a chance for a few showers and storms after 10 AM in the mountains and after 1 PM in the Upstate. Isolated to widely scattered storms continue into the evening and early overnight hours before dying down into early Saturday.
